Transaction 521db7844997e0cf9186c43144d25927c8b96b3cc20c09cc454410d2ee8e8f79

3 Input
2 Outputs
  • 521db7844997e0cf9186c43144d25927c8b96b3cc20c09cc454410d2ee8e8f79:0
  • value  57267
    address  1JuAEEcsvq8zMPfEsqJ18JB2A7C2vJ2vnS
  • 521db7844997e0cf9186c43144d25927c8b96b3cc20c09cc454410d2ee8e8f79:1
  • value  4046585
    address  1GHLjxbnvv7Cfdb2jA3YhDLB8MY5AS63Ed